UnixODBC — это стандартный драйвер для связи с базами данных, работающими под управлением операционных систем семейства Unix. Этот инструмент позволяет программистам работать с различными типами баз данных, используя единый интерфейс.
Если вы только начинаете изучать UnixODBC или планируете использовать его в своих проектах, мы подготовили для вас пошаговую инструкцию по его установке.
Шаг 1: Установка UnixODBC с помощью менеджера пакетов
Самый простой способ установить UnixODBC — это использовать менеджер пакетов вашей операционной системы. Вот команды для некоторых из них:
Ubuntu:
sudo apt-get install unixodbc unixodbc-dev
CentOS:
sudo yum install unixODBC unixODBC-devel
Шаг 2: Подготовка конфигурационного файла
После установки UnixODBC необходимо создать и настроить конфигурационный файл odbc.ini. Этот файл содержит информацию о базах данных, с которыми вы планируете взаимодействовать.
Вы можете создать этот файл в вашей домашней директории следующей командой:
touch ~/.odbc.ini
Затем откройте этот файл в текстовом редакторе и добавьте следующую информацию для каждой базы данных:
[имя_базы_данных]
Driver = /путь/к/драйверу
Server = адрес_сервера
Port = порт_сервера
Database = имя_базы
Username = ваше_имя_пользователя
Password = ваш_пароль
Сохраните и закройте файл odbc.ini.
Шаг 3: Подключение к базе данных
Теперь вы готовы подключиться к базе данных с помощью UnixODBC. В вашем коде вы можете использовать следующий код для подключения:
OdbcConnection connection = new OdbcConnection(«DSN=имя_базы_данных»);
Где «имя_базы_данных» — это имя базы данных, которое вы указали в odbc.ini.
Теперь вы знаете, как установить и использовать UnixODBC для работы с базами данных в операционных системах Unix. Удачной работы!
- Шаг 1: Получение необходимого программного обеспечения
- Как скачать и установить необходимые компоненты unixODBC
- Шаг 2 — Подготовка к установке unixODBC
- Настройка системы и установка зависимостей перед установкой unixODBC
- Шаг 3 — Сборка и установка unixODBC
- Как выполнить сборку и установку unixODBC из исходных файлов
- Шаг 4 — Настройка unixODBC
Шаг 1: Получение необходимого программного обеспечения
Для установки unixODBC вам понадобятся следующие компоненты:
- Компилятор C++, такой как gcc
- Утилиты для работы с архивами, например, tar и gzip
- Система управления пакетами, такая как apt или yum, для установки зависимостей unixODBC
Если вы используете Linux, вам может потребоваться выполнить следующую команду, чтобы установить необходимые компоненты:
sudo apt-get install build-essential tar gzip
Если вы используете другую операционную систему, обратитесь к соответствующей документации по установке программного обеспечения.
После того, как вы получили все необходимые компоненты, вы готовы перейти к следующему шагу.
Как скачать и установить необходимые компоненты unixODBC
Шаг 1: Перейдите на официальный сайт проекта unixODBC по адресу: http://www.unixodbc.org/.
Шаг 2: На главной странице сайта найдите ссылку «Download», и кликните по ней.
Шаг 3: На странице загрузки выберите последнюю версию unixODBC, совместимую с вашей операционной системой. Обратите внимание на разрядность (32-бит или 64-бит) вашей системы.
Шаг 4: После выбора версии, кликните по ссылке для загрузки соответствующего архива с исходными кодами unixODBC.
Шаг 5: По окончании загрузки, откройте терминал и перейдите в каталог, в котором расположен архив с исходными кодами unixODBC.
Шаг 6: Распакуйте архив, используя команду:
tar -xvf unixODBC-x.x.x.tar.gz
Замените x.x.x
на соответствующую версию unixODBC.
Шаг 7: Перейдите в распакованную директорию, используя команду:
cd unixODBC-x.x.x
Шаг 8: Соберите и установите unixODBC, выполнив следующие команды в терминале:
./configure
make
sudo make install
Обратите внимание, что последняя команда (sudo make install
) требует прав администратора для успешного выполнения.
Шаг 9: По окончании установки, проверьте, что unixODBC работает корректно, выполнив следующую команду:
isql -v
Если установка прошла успешно, вы увидите информацию о версии unixODBC, а также приглашение к вводу SQL-запросов.
Поздравляем! Вы успешно скачали и установили необходимые компоненты unixODBC.
Шаг 2 — Подготовка к установке unixODBC
Перед установкой unixODBC необходимо выполнить несколько предварительных шагов для правильной настройки системы.
1. Обновление системы
Перед началом установки рекомендуется обновить систему до последней версии. Для этого выполните следующую команду в терминале:
sudo apt update && sudo apt upgrade
Данная команда обновит все установленные пакеты до последней версии и установит все доступные обновления.
2. Установка необходимых зависимостей
Для корректной работы unixODBC потребуются некоторые зависимости. Введите следующую команду для их установки:
sudo apt install libodbc1
Данная команда установит пакет libodbc1, который является необходимой зависимостью для unixODBC.
3. Проверка установки
После установки зависимостей можно проверить их наличие и корректную работу. Для этого выполните команду:
odbcinst -j
Настройка системы и установка зависимостей перед установкой unixODBC
Для успешной установки и работы unixODBC на вашей системе необходимо выполнить предварительные работы и установить все необходимые зависимости. Вот пошаговая инструкция:
1. Проверьте, установлены ли на вашей системе необходимые инструменты для сборки и установки пакетов. Для этого выполните команду в терминале:
sudo apt-get install build-essential
2. Обновите список пакетов и установите необходимые зависимости, выполнив следующую команду:
sudo apt-get update
sudo apt-get install unixodbc-dev
3. Установите дополнительные инструменты, необходимые для работы with unixODBC:
sudo apt-get install libtool
4. Установите драйверы для конкретных баз данных (например, для MySQL) . Вам могут понадобиться различные драйверы в зависимости от того, с какими базами данных вы планируете работать. Для установки драйвера MySQL выполните команду:
sudo apt-get install libmyodbc
5. После установки всех зависимостей и драйверов вы готовы установить unixODBC. Скачайте исходный код unixODBC с официального сайта (https://www.unixodbc.org/) или с помощью git:
git clone https://github.com/lurcher/unixODBC.git
6. Перейдите в каталог скачанного исходного кода:
cd unixODBC
7. Выполните последовательность команд для сборки и установки:
./configure
make
sudo make install
8. После успешной установки unixODBC проверьте, что она работает корректно. Выполните следующую команду:
odbcinst -j
Поздравляю! Теперь вы готовы использовать unixODBC на вашей системе.
Шаг 3 — Сборка и установка unixODBC
- Откройте консоль и перейдите в папку, в которую вы загрузили исходный код unixODBC.
- Выполните следующие команды для сборки и установки:
./configure
— эта команда проверяет вашу систему и создает файлы для сборки.make
— эта команда запускает процесс сборки пакета unixODBC.sudo make install
— эта команда устанавливает собранный пакет unixODBC.- После успешной установки вы можете проверить, что unixODBC установлен, выполнив команду
odbcinst --version
в командной строке. Если версия unixODBC отображается, значит, установка прошла успешно.
Теперь unixODBC готов к использованию, и вы можете переходить к настройке и использованию драйверов и источников данных.
Как выполнить сборку и установку unixODBC из исходных файлов
Для выполнения сборки и установки unixODBC из исходных файлов, следуйте этим шагам:
1. Загрузите исходные файлы:
Перейдите на официальный сайт unixODBC и скачайте последнюю версию исходных файлов. Распакуйте скачанный архив на вашем компьютере.
2. Подготовка к сборке:
Перейдите в каталог с распакованными исходными файлами. Выполните команду «./configure», чтобы настроить сборку unixODBC. При необходимости, вы можете передать опции конфигурации, чтобы изменить настройки.
3. Запуск сборки:
После успешной настройки сборки выполните команду «make». Это запустит процесс сборки unixODBC из исходных файлов.
4. Установка:
После завершения сборки выполните команду «sudo make install». Она установит unixODBC в вашу систему. При необходимости, вы можете изменить путь установки, передав опцию «—prefix» в команде configure.
5. Проверка установки:
После установки unixODBC, вы можете выполнить команду «odbcinst -j», чтобы проверить, что его установка прошла успешно. Вы должны получить информацию о различных установленных драйверах и параметрах.
Поздравляю! Вы успешно выполнели сборку и установку unixODBC из исходных файлов! Теперь вы можете использовать эту мощную библиотеку для работы с базами данных в UNIX-подобных системах.
Шаг 4 — Настройка unixODBC
После успешной установки unixODBC необходимо выполнить некоторые настройки, чтобы его можно было использовать для подключения к базе данных.
1. Откройте файл /etc/odbcinst.ini
в текстовом редакторе.
2. Добавьте следующую секцию в конец файла:
Вставьте следующий код в конец файла: |
---|
[MySQL] Description = MySQL ODBC Driver Driver = /path/to/MySQL/ODBC/Driver FileUsage = 1 |
Здесь необходимо заменить /path/to/MySQL/ODBC/Driver
на путь до установленного драйвера MySQL ODBC.
3. Сохраните изменения и закройте файл.
4. Откройте файл /etc/odbc.ini
в текстовом редакторе.
5. Добавьте следующую секцию в конец файла:
Вставьте следующий код в конец файла: |
---|
[MyDSN] Driver = MySQL Server = localhost Port = 3306 Database = mydatabase User = myuser Password = mypassword Option = 3 |
Здесь необходимо заменить значения параметров Server
, Database
, User
и Password
на соответствующие значения вашей базы данных MySQL.
6. Сохраните изменения и закройте файл.
Теперь unixODBC готов к использованию. В следующем шаге мы рассмотрим пример кода для подключения к базе данных с использованием unixODBC.